How do you write a research methodology for a report?

  1. Step 1: Explain your methodological approach. Begin by introducing your overall approach to the research.
  2. Step 2: Describe your methods of data collection.
  3. Step 3: Describe your methods of analysis.
  4. Step 4: Evaluate and justify your methodological choices.

What do you write in the methodology section?

The methodology section should clearly show why your methods suit your objectives and convince the reader that you chose the best possible approach to answering your problem statement and research questions. Throughout the section, relate your choices back to the central purpose of your dissertation.

What is research methodology in a report?

Research methodology is the specific procedures or techniques used to identify, select, process, and analyze information about a topic. In a research paper, the methodology section allows the reader to critically evaluate a study’s overall validity and reliability.

What does research methodology mean in a thesis?

Research methods or methodology usually refers to the specific steps, tools, and procedures used to collect and analyze data. In a thesis, aspects of the research design will often be explained in both the introduction and the methodology chapter.
